Make sure the pan is hot enough before you pour the oil, and then give a few seconds to heat the oil.Then very gently layer the marinated fish and don't move it for 1 minute. Let it fry and then gently flip and fry for 1 minute.If the pan is hot enough and the oil is hot, the fish will not stick to the pan and will flip nicely.| www.playfulcooking.com
